Parishioners from cluster area advised to stay away for 14 days


Sacred Heart Cathedral in Sibu.

ALL Catholics from Meradong, Sarikei, Julau and Bintangor have been advised not to attend church service at Sacred Heart Cathedral, Sibu after a new Covid-19 cluster, the Mador Club has been identified in Bintangor.

Sacred Heart Cathedral rector Father Philip Hu wanted Catholics from the said places to refrain from coming to the parish and its Laudato Si Canteen for a period of 14 days starting Jan 2.
